Why Automation Matters in Modern Job Hunting

According to a 2023 LinkedIn survey, 62% of job seekers say “manual application tracking” is the biggest time‑sink in their search. The same report shows that candidates who use automation tools land interviews 30% faster on average. Automation frees mental bandwidth for higher‑value activities like networking and interview preparation.

Stat: The average job seeker spends 10‑12 hours per week on repetitive tasks (source: Glassdoor Career Insights).

By automating these low‑value steps you can reclaim those hours and focus on tailoring your story, building relationships, and sharpening interview skills.

Step‑by‑Step Automation Roadmap

1. Centralize Your Job Data

  1. Create a master spreadsheet (or use Resumly’s Application Tracker) with columns for Company, Role, URL, Status, and Follow‑up Date.
  2. Import existing applications using the CSV import feature on the tracker page.
  3. Set up Zapier or Make.com to automatically add new jobs from LinkedIn or Indeed RSS feeds into the sheet.

5. Schedule Automated Follow‑Ups

  1. In your tracker, set a follow‑up date 7‑10 days after each application.
  2. Use a simple Google Apps Script or the built‑in reminder feature to send a templated email.
  3. Track responses automatically via the “Replies” column.

Do’s and Don’ts of Job‑Search Automation

Do:

  • Use AI to customize content, not to copy‑paste generic text.
  • Keep a human touch in networking messages; personalize the first sentence.
  • Regularly review automated outputs for accuracy and tone.

Don’t:

  • Rely solely on automation for research; always read the full job description.
  • Spam recruiters with mass‑sent messages; quality beats quantity.
  • Forget to update your tracker; stale data leads to missed deadlines.
